I did not mention this in the report from the 30th
(because I thought I have nothing much to write about the 31st anymore
if I tell everything on the 30th report!(laugh)) but the Blue and White
night were the first times that X performed "Dahlia", "Longing" and "Scars"
on stage!!! At that time "Scars" was still called "Scars on Melody"...
very good!!!

There is one more special thing about the Blue and
White night... at the entrance before getting into the Dome every visitor
was handed a cassette. That cassette contains the first version of "Longing",
still with different verses... not "I'll sing without you..." but "I'll
be without you..." I personally prefer this version of "Longing" and not
the one the was pressed on CD later. Since I went both days I got two cassettes,
but I gave one to a friend who could not come to the concert because she
was lying in hospital at that time, so I have only one left... Last time
I was in Tokyo I saw this cassette in some J-rock shop and it sold for
9000 Yen!!! And we got it for free when we went to the Blue and White Nights!!!
